I think this has to be my favourite Porcupine Tree album. I do love Voyage 34 which is a very different experience (particularly after a few beers) but this tops it! The opening riff on track 1 is a stonker! 'Trains' is a class track. 'Heartattack in a Layby' is ethereal. 'Strip the Soul' complex.

Average Rating = (n ÷ (n + m)) × av + (m ÷ (n + m)) × AVwhere:
av = trimmed mean average rating an item has currently received.
n = number of ratings an item has currently received.
m = minimum number of ratings required for an item to appear in a 'top-rated' chart (currently 10).
AV = the site mean average rating.
